CITY BIKE

Bike rental

Rental of classic and electric bikes, for 2 hours or 24 hours. The 2h formula is not really interesting because pedalling in the city centre is not very interesting (lots of people, cobblestones everywhere, few bike paths...), but a daily rental will allow you to go green in the parks around the city centre instead of taking the metro, which can be a pleasant walk and lead to great discoveries. There are also several options for guided bike tours lasting from 2 to 2 hours and a half.

AVIS

Car rental

Strategically located between Revoluční and Wilsonova, Avis Prague has a range of vehicles with promotional offers all year round, from small electric city cars to spacious, comfortable tourers, depending on the type of trip you're planning in the Czech Republic. You'll also be able to see for yourself how impressive the upscale positioning of Škoda, the national brand acquired by Volkswagen, has been in recent years. It makes up the bulk of the local fleet and is a pleasure to drive.

ROYAL RENT A CAR

Car rental

Just a stone's throw from Wenceslas Square, this small family agency gives you all the advice you need to make your trip to the Czech Republic memorable. Low prices, a wide range of cars available in all ranges and a package that allows you to drop off your car in foreign countries (example 500 Kč to drop off your car anywhere in France or Belgium). It's a little expensive, but it's rare to go to a car rental company and find a truly personalized service and advice on the country.

YELLOW ZEBRA TOURS

Bike rental

This service provider located in the city center has a nice fleet of classic bikes and electric bikes (very useful when you have to go up to the castle!). Bikes can be rented by the hour, for 2 hours, for half a day or for a day, and there are also many organized excursions, free or commented, oriented on the landscapes or on the history of the city. A great way to discover Prague. For a day, it costs 500 to 1,500 kč per day depending on the type of bike, and a deposit is required for electric bikes.

OKOLO BIKES

Bike rental

Prague is not a cycling capital, but exploring the city and its surroundings on two wheels is a great idea! Okolo is a small rental agency based in the city centre, near the Municipal House. Michal, the manager, studied in France for part of his life, so he will welcome you in French and advise you on the best bike routes in and around the city. Several models are available, as well as a wide range of accessories. The bikes are in very good condition, and rentals are affordable. We recommend.
